Method

Base & Mixing

  1. 1

    Combine spirits and juices

    In a large pitcher (about 2 quart / 2 L capacity), add 1 cup light rum and 1/2 cup dark rum. Pour in 1 1/4 cups pineapple juice, 3/4 cup orange juice, and 1/2 cup mango nectar. Stir gently to combine.

  2. 2

    Add citrus and sweeteners

    Add 1/4 cup fresh lime juice, 2 tablespoons simple syrup, and 2 teaspoons grenadine to the pitcher. Stir well for 20–30 seconds until the sweeteners are evenly incorporated.

Chill & Adjust

  1. 3

    Taste the punch and adjust balance: if it needs more brightness, add up to 1 tablespoon additional lime juice; if it needs more sweetness, add up to 1 tablespoon more simple syrup. The mixture should be sweet-tart and fruit-forward.

  2. 4

    Place the pitcher in the refrigerator to chill for at least 30 minutes if time allows. Alternatively, continue with serving over ice immediately for quicker service.

Finish & Serve

  1. 5

    Add ice and fizz

    Just before serving, add 4 cups of cubed ice into the pitcher (or into individual glasses). Pour in 1 cup chilled club soda and stir gently to incorporate fizz without flattening.

  2. 6

    Bitters for depth

    Add 4 dashes of Angostura bitters to the punch and give a light stir. The bitters add aromatic depth and help tie the fruit flavors together.

  3. 7

    Garnish and portion

    Ladle or pour Nikki's Trap Punch into 4 tall glasses. Garnish each glass with a pineapple wedge, an orange slice, a maraschino cherry, and a mint sprig. Optionally, thread the fruit and cherry on a cocktail pick for a festive presentation.
